Gather Your Ingredients

Prep Time: 10 minutes | Cook Time: 15 minutes | Servings: 4

  • 8 oz linguini
  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 4 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up white wine (optional)
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
  • Juice of 1 lemon

Let’s Get Cooking

  1. Start by cooking the linguini according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.

  2. In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.

  3. Add the shrimp to the skillet, season with sal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the shrimp turn pink.

  4. If using, pour in the white wine and let it simmer for another 2 minutes to reduce slightly.

  5. Stir in the cooked linguini, lemon juice, and toss everything together until well combined.

  6. Garnish with fresh parsley and serve immediately.

FAQs

Q: Can I use frozen shrimp for this recipe?

A: Absolutely! Just make sure to thaw them completely before cooking.

Q: What if I don’t have white wine?

A: You can substitute it with chicken broth or simply omit it; the dish will still be delicious!
